timothy on Jul 15th, 2008How the Flower Industry Works

The flower industry, or floriculture, is a dynamic, fast-growing industry happening on a global scale.  The countries with the biggest flower-growing industry are The Netherlands, Kenya, Colombia, and Israel, but many other nations such as The Philippines, Malaysia, South Africa, and Ecuador are joining the market and investing in the industry.
